Can I run US-made electrical devices (appliances, stereos, computers) in the UK?
Bing! You’ve just asked the very most Frequently Asked Question regarding a move to the UK. The UK, of course, has a completely different electrical standard than the US (in terms of voltage, current available, frequency, and physical plugs).
